Jamaica’s Natural Wonders

Jamaica boasts of several natural wonders that are worth exploring. The Blue Mountain Peak, standing at 7,402 feet, is the highest peak in Jamaica and a hiker’s paradise. The mountain offers breathtaking panoramic views of the island, including the famous Blue Mountains coffee plantations. I had the opportunity to hike the peak at dawn, and the view of the sunrise was nothing short of spectacular.

Another natural wonder worth visiting is Dunn’s River Falls, located in Ocho Rios. The magnificent waterfall cascades over limestone rocks, creating a stunning backdrop for photo enthusiasts.

Jamaica is also home to several limestone caves, including the Green Grotto Caves, which are over 1,500 years old. The caves offer a unique experience of exploring the underground world, including secret chambers and underground lakes. The tour guide was knowledgeable and gave us insights into the history and geology of the caves.

Marine Life and Clear Waters

Jamaica’s crystal clear waters and marine life are a paradise for snorkeling and scuba diving enthusiasts. The Caribbean Sea is home to numerous fish species, including parrotfish, blue tang, and barracudas. The view in Montego Bay’s colorful coral reefs and sea life was breathtaking.

Another popular spot for underwater adventure is the luminous Lagoon, located in Falmouth. The lagoon is home to microscopic organisms that emit a blue-green light, creating a stunning glow at night. During my boat tour, I immersed my hands in the water and witnessed a magical luminescence.

River Adventure

Jamaica’s rivers provide numerous opportunities for those seeking outdoor adventure. In particular, the Rio Grande River offers an unforgettable and memorable experience for thrill-seekers.

Rafting on a bamboo raft gives visitors a chance to take in the beauty of the rainforest. Our rafting tour is led by experienced local captains. They will provide insight into the river and the plants and wildlife that inhabit it.

Another river adventure worth exploring is the Martha Brae River, located in Falmouth. The river is ideal for a relaxing river rafting experience while enjoying the scenic view of the Jamaican countryside. The tour guide shared interesting stories about the river and its history, making the experience enjoyable and informative.

Forest Adventure

Jamaica has a lush rainforest that is home to several hidden gems and jungle adventures. The Mayfield Falls, located in Westmoreland, is a hidden gem worth exploring. The falls offer a unique experience of swimming in natural pools, climbing the cascading falls, and enjoying natural waterfall.

Another forest adventure worth exploring is the Cockpit Country, located in Trelawny. The rugged terrain is home to several endemic species, including the Jamaican boa and the giant swallowtail butterfly. I enjoyed hiking the trails and exploring the limestone caves while learning about the unique flora and fauna of Jamaica.

Adrenaline and Thrilling Activities

Those who love adrenaline-filled adventures can find plenty of thrilling activities in Jamaica. Mystic Mountain in Ocho Rios offers a unique bobsled ride experience. It replicates the Jamaican bobsled team’s Olympic journey. The ride takes you through the rainforest while enjoying the scenic view of the island.

Another thrilling activity worth exploring is the Zipline canopy tour, located in Montego Bay. The tour takes you through the rainforest while zipping through the trees, providing a stunning bird’s eye view of the island.

Beach Adventure

Jamaica’s beaches are a paradise for relaxation and enjoying the island’s attractions. The Seven Mile Beach, located in Negril, is a popular spot for sunbathing and enjoying the sunset. The beach offers numerous activities, including snorkeling, parasailing, and jet skiing.

Another beach worth exploring is Doctor’s Cave Beach, located in Montego Bay. The beach has crystal waters and a white sand beach, making it an ideal spot for swimming and enjoying the sun. The beach also has a rich history, including a bathing club that was established in 1906.

Planning Your Jamaica Adventure Trip

Planning a trip to Jamaica is relatively easy, and there are several travel agencies that offer affordable packages. When planning your trip, consider to visit between November and mid-December when the island is less crowded.
